Short version:
The situation at Auburn has remained unusually fluid during Hand's tenure.

Long version:
-Everything started clicking about the same time Hand and Lindsey traded places on the sideline and in the box. That's a pretty significant change. *For the purposes of this conversation, responsibility for the existing arrangement and the change is irrelevant.* 

-The offense may or may not have changed significantly in other ways around that same time. Same with the previous year. You likely already have your opinions about that. *Again, just offering the possibility. I hope anyone actually reading this will join me in leaving it there.*

-Center is possibly the 2nd-most cerebral position in football. I can forgive a coach for taking a minute to get a guy new to our team and new to D1 football ready to take the reigns, especially with the luxury of having Golson there. I view the center position as the lead domino in the OL shuffle this year, but I could be wrong. 

-Tega played well for a rookie. He was benched because Golson was a vastly more experienced guy who, once freed up from other duties, was a no brainer to take over at LT. 

-Hand has been working primarily with Grimes's recruits. By itself, it's not an excuse. Taken into account with all the other fluidity over the last 2 seasons in addition to that already stated above- broken jaws, changing OCs, certain game plans that seemed to be significant departures from the norm, multiple QBs with vastly different skillsets in some cases, about 17 different issues at RB that often changed the game plan... I mean, has he had a single constant other than Braden Smith?- it's worth mentioning. 

-*It's generally accepted that Gus's offenses are never settled until 3-4 games in. I take that into consideration when assessing the OL and their coach's performance. 

The theme is, ironically, consistent: Auburn football has been a box of chocolates for Herb Hand, probably even more than it has been for we fans. The extent to which he has contributed to that can be discussed, but he is not in charge and I personally assume him to be more victim than perpetrator thus far in his tenure.

 

*I find very valid reasons for this- reasons that did not apply in 2014, when the offense was in 5th gear in week 1. Unfortunately, we do not return a Rimington-winning center this season.
